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Dealing with a minor leak under 1 inch in diameter Yes No DIY repairs for small leaks are often straightforward and cost-effective.
Experiencing significant water damage covering over 50% of your home’s square footage No Yes Large-scale water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to ensure a thorough and safe restoration.
Identifying signs of mold growth in your home’s ductwork or walls No Yes Mold remediation needs specialized equipment, training, and safety measures to prevent further health risks.
Trying to remove standing water from a flooded area without proper equipment No Yes Removing standing water without proper equipment can lead to electrical shock, slipping hazards, or further damage to your property.
Notifying your insurance provider about a water damage claim within a timely manner Yes Yes Prompt notification of a water damage claim to your insurance provider can help ensure a smoother claims process and maximum coverage.
Not addressing water damage to your home’s foundation or structural integrity No Yes Failing to address water damage to your home’s foundation or structural integrity can lead to costly repairs down the line.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Emergency Response and Water Extraction $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area, the type of water involved, and the equipment required will impact the cost.
Water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area, the type of equipment required, and the duration of the drying process will impact the cost.
Reconstruction and Repair $5,000 – $20,000 The extent of the damage, the type of materials required, and the labor involved will impact the cost.

How Long Does Water Damage Restoration Typically Take?

Water damage restoration can take anywhere from 3-5 days to several weeks, depending on the severity and size of the affected area.

What Happens If I Delay Water Damage Restoration?

Delaying water damage restoration can lead to costly repairs down the line, as well as create an environment conducive to mold growth and further health risks.
